The New England Patriots were originally supposed to play a second straight primetime game in Week 15, hosting the Kansas City Chiefs on Monday Night Football. However, their matchup with the reigning world champions were flexed out of that slot and moved into Sunday afternoon. Why? A look at the Chiefs entering the contest as 9.5-point favorites according to DraftKings Sportsbook gives us a clue. The Patriots’ issues this season and 2-9 record at the time of the flexing decision in late November have forced the league’s hand. And with New England still just 3-10 versus the 8-5 Chiefs, things are not looking a whole lot more competitive right now. That being said, the old “any given Sunday” mantra still rings true. Chiefs key stats For year, the Chiefs under head coach Andy Reid were known for their offensive prowess rather than their defensive abilities. However, in 2023, that is not entirely true: the Kansas City defense has been among the stingiest in the game, and is actually out-ranking the offense in points and yards per game. With the unit one of the best in the league so far, and the offense still more than adequate, it is no surprise to see the club again atop the AFC West and with an impressive scoring differential.

- Record: 8-5 (1st AFC West)
- Offense: 22.5 points/game (11th), 361.3 yards/game (7th), 0.055 EPA/play (7th)
- Defense: 17.5 points/game (3rd), 299.9 yards/game (6th), -0.049 EPA/play (11th)
- Scoring differential: +64 (6th)
- Turnover differential: -7 (t-27th)
